How do I forward a web page to another person

more options

I often want to forward web pages to friends, and used to be able to do this before I got a new hard drive put in. I used to be able to click an orange cross which opened an email forwarding screen that I filled in, then sent the page. I don't see that now and wonder whether there's something similar I can use. My searches on the web have thusfar been fruitless, and as usual, the Firefox answers don't help. What can you tell me?

Chosen solution

There is a FIREFOX addon, Capture and Email this web page, which does all the work for you when you want to forward a web page to someone. You need only type in which email address you are using and the password for that. It is easy, accurate and very efficient, even sending a copy of what you sent to your own email address.

First, open the email client and start a new message. You can highlight the address of the current page in the address bar of Firefox, copy it to the clipboard, then paste it into a message. You can do the same for links, except you right-click the link and choose "Copy link location".
